Abstract
The utility model discloses a kind of tilting-type gates, the tilting-type gate includes the gate that bottom is hinged on river or water channel bottom by hinge, it is turned on or off the headstock gear of gate, and the driving motor of driving headstock gear operation, one end of headstock gear is connected with the output end of driving motor, it is fixedly connected at the top of the other end and gate, the axis rotation of top around hinge under the operation of headstock gear of gate.The utility model tilting-type gate allows gate to overturn by the structure of wirerope or screw rod, to realize the opening and closing of gate, has the advantages that structure is simple, light-weight rigidity is good, easy for installation, spacial influence is small.

Specific embodiment
With reference to the accompanying drawings and examples, specific embodiment of the present utility model is described in further detail.Below
Embodiment cannot be used to limit the scope of the utility model for illustrating the utility model.
Embodiment one
The structural schematic diagram of the utility model tilting-type gate as shown in Figure 1, its side structure as shown in Fig. 2, the river
Road or water channel bottom are provided with the first pre-embedded steel slab 91, which is arranged along the width direction of river or water channel,
The tilting-type gate includes the gate 1 that bottom is hinged on the first pre-embedded steel slab 91 by hinge 8, is turned on or off gate
Headstock gear, and the driving motor 4 of driving headstock gear operation, one end of headstock gear and the output end phase of driving motor 4
Connection, the other end are fixedly connected with the top of gate 1, the axis rotation of top around hinge 8 under the operation of headstock gear of gate 1
Turn.
Above-mentioned headstock gear is two groups, and two groups of headstock gears are respectively arranged in river or the second of water channel both sides of the edge pre-buried
On steel plate 92, two groups of headstock gear synchronous operations, avoidable gate shifts, stabilization when improving gate opening or closing
Property.
Above-mentioned driving motor 4 is fixedly mounted on the second pre-embedded steel slab 92, can be one, while driving two groups of opening and closings
Device is also possible to two, connect respectively with two groups of headstock gears, two groups of headstock gears of synchronous driving.
Hinge hinged seat 10 is fixedly installed on above-mentioned first pre-embedded steel slab 91, described hinged 8 one end is fixedly mounted on
On the hinge hinged seat 10, the other end is fixedly mounted on the bottom of above-mentioned gate 1.
Above-mentioned headstock gear includes the roller 31 connecting with 4 output end of driving motor, the wirerope being wrapped on roller 31
32, it is fixedly mounted on the pulley 33 at 1 top of gate, and be fixedly mounted on the fast pulley 34 of 31 lower section of roller, the one of wirerope
End is fixedly connected on roller 31, and the other end is fixedly connected on fast pulley 34 after bypassing pulley 33.
The side of above-mentioned river or water channel is fixedly installed with third pre-embedded steel slab 93, the third pre-embedded steel slab 93 and institute
It states the second pre-embedded steel slab 92 to be vertical setting, above-mentioned fast pulley 34 is fixedly mounted on the third pre-embedded steel slab 93.
Directive wheel 35 is installed, wirerope 32 bypasses directive wheel 35, and the directive wheel 35 is fixed between roller 31 and pulley 33
It is mounted on the lower section of the second pre-embedded steel slab 92.Directive wheel is wound on roller or from roller in an orderly manner for guiding steel wire rope
Release guarantees that wirerope orderly wind or discharges, and avoids wirerope knotting and influences the normal use of headstock gear.
When starting gate, driving motor is run, driving roller rotation is released the wirerope in roller, gate exists
Under the action of self gravity, the axis of around hinge is overturn to water-bed direction, with starting gate;When closed shutter, driving motor is anti-
To operation, roller is driven to reversely rotate, wirerope is constantly wound in roller, around hinge under the pullling of wirerope at the top of gate
The axis of chain is overturn to water surface direction, with closed shutter.
The 4th reserved steel plate 94 is fixedly mounted in river or water channel bottom, and the 4th reserved steel plate 94 is along river or water channel width
Direction is arranged, and is fixedly installed with sealing support 7 on the 4th reserved steel plate 94, is fixedly installed with first on the sealing support 7 and stops
Water roller 71, the bottom of gate 1 are provided with the second sealing roller 11, and the second sealing roller 11 is resisted against the first sealing roller 71.
To prevent water from leaking from the gap of hinged seat or articulated link chain.
Second sealing roller 11 is rubber cylinder, stuck to avoid causing because of the out-of-flatness of the first sealing cylinder surface
State.
Embodiment two
As shown in Figures 3 to 6, compared with embodiment one, the difference of embodiment two is: being only that the skill of headstock gear
Art scheme is different.The headstock gear includes the screw rod 21 connecting with 4 output end of driving motor, the walking being threadedly engaged with screw rod 21
Nut 22, and the connecting rod 23 of connection walking nut 22 and gate 1, the both ends of connecting rod 23 are respectively hinged at walking nut 22, lock
1 top of door.
Guide rail 6 is provided with above screw rod 21, the top of walking nut 22 is provided with the guide wheel 221 rolled along guide rail 6, rises
To guiding role.
The 5th reserved steel plate 95, the 5th reserved 95 edge of steel plate are fixedly installed between above-mentioned river or the two sides of water channel
River or the setting of water channel length direction, above-mentioned guide rail 6 are fixedly mounted on the lower section of the 5th reserved steel plate 95, above-mentioned screw rod 21
Support is in the lower section of the guide rail 6.The lower section of guide rail 6 is provided with support base 61, one end of the screw rod 21 and the output end of driving motor
It is fixedly connected, the other end is by bearing support on the support base 61.
It is threadedly coupled on screw rod 21 there are two nut 24 is stablized, two stable nuts 24 are respectively arranged at walking nut 22
Two sides, and be all fixedly connected with walking nut 22, for the walking of stabilized walking nut, improve the stabilization of headstock gear operation
Property.
The top of above-mentioned two stable nut 24 is also both provided with above-mentioned guide wheel 221, and rolls along guide rail.
The lower section of walking nut 22, the top of gate 1 are provided with a hinged seat 5, and connecting rod 23 is hinged on hinged seat 5,
To realize the hinged of connecting rod.
When unlatching, driving motor is driven, driving screw rod rotation so that nut be driven to slide along screw axis direction, and is led to
Crossing connecting rod drives the axis of gate around hinge to overturn to water-bed direction, to realize the unlatching of gate;When closing, it is driven in the reverse direction driving
Motor reversely rotates screw rod, and nut is made rotate with reversed direction when opening, the axis of drive gate around hinge to
Water surface direction overturning, to realize the closing of gate.
